Kornit Digital (NASDAQ:KRNT) Stock Price Crosses Above 50 Day Moving Average – What’s Next?

Kornit Digital Ltd. (NASDAQ:KRNTGet Free Report) shares crossed above its 50 day moving average during trading on Friday . The stock has a 50 day moving average of $15.82 and traded as high as $16.08. Kornit Digital shares last traded at $16.06, with a volume of 187,728 shares changing hands.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ades

A number of research firms recently issued reports on KRNT. Morgan Stanley increased their price target on shares of Kornit Digital from $17.00 to $18.00 and gave the stock an “equal weight” rating in a research note on Tuesday. Wall Street Zen raised Kornit Digital from a “s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Sunday, April 12th. Needham & Company LLC increased their target price on Kornit Digital from $20.00 to $22.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research report on Thursday, May 14th. Finally, Weiss Ratings reissued a “sell (d-)” rating on shares of Kornit Digital in a research report on Wednesday, March 25th. Two research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, two have issued a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the company. According to MarketBeat, Kornit Digital pres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$21.00.

Kornit Digital Stock Performance

The stock has a market capitalization of $719.33 million, a P/E ratio of -41.18 and a beta of 1.75.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$15.82 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$15.07.

Kornit Digital (NASDAQ:KRNTG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 13th. The industrial products company reported ($0.01) earnings per share for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of ($0.01). The business had revenue of $48.54 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$46.67 million. Kornit Digital had a negative net margin of 7.93% and a negative return on equity of 1.15%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 4.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m earned $0.01 earnings per share. On average, research analysts anticipate that Kornit Digital Ltd. will post -0.28 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Institutional Inflows and Outflows

Several hedge funds and other institutional investors have recently added to or reduced their stakes in the business. Polar Asset Management Partners Inc. increased its holdings in shares of Kornit Digital by 21.1% during the 3rd quarter. Polar Asset Management Partners Inc. now owns 779,559 shares of the industrial products company’s stock valued at $10,524,000 after purchasing an additional 135,709 shares in the last quarter. Invenomic Capital Management LP acquired a new position in shares of Kornit Digital in the 3rd quarter valued at $6,356,000. Medina Value Partners LLC purchased a new stake in Kornit Digital during the third quarter worth $12,732,000. Thompson Investment Management Inc. increased its stake in shares of Kornit Digital by 11.0% in the 4th quarter. Thompson Investment Management Inc. now owns 876,977 shares of the industrial products company’s stock valued at $12,611,000 after purchasing an additional 87,216 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Ironwood Investment Management LLC purchased a new stake in shares of Kornit Digital in the third quarter valued at approximately $1,006,000. 92.76%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ors.

Kornit Digital Company Profile

Kornit Digital Ltd. (NASDAQ: KRNT) is a global technology company specializing in digital textile printing solutions. Headquartered in Rosh Ha’Ayin, Israel, Kornit develops and manufactures an integrated ecosystem of industrial inkjet printers, proprietary NeoPigment inks and pretreatment systems. Its product portfolio addresses a range of applications including direct-to-garment, direct-to-fabric, digital embellishment and hybrid manufacturing, enabling businesses to produce custom apparel, sportswear, fashion and home textiles on demand.

The company’s flagship offerings include the Avalanche and Atlas series for high-volume production, as well as the Storm and Helix lines designed for mid-to-large scale operations.
